OpenStack现在可配置NoSQL

日期: 2014-05-11 来源:TechTarget中国 英文

专注于Trove数据库组件的OpenStack开发商Tesora公司宣布与Red Hat和MongoDB建立合作伙伴关系,让OpenStack更好地管理NoSQL解决方案。

OpenStack的Trove子组件能够允许数据库在OpenStack内管理,具有与任何其他资源相同的灵活性和透明度,例如存储或网络。这并不是一个实验性技术,现在eBay和Rackspace正在生产环境中使用这种技术。

到目前为止,唯一能够在OpenStack内配置的数据库是MySQL,因为MySQL无处不在,并受到广泛理解的数据库,同时也是最可能通过OpenStack实现广泛管理和执行配置的数据库类型。但MySQL并不是唯一能够通过OpenStack管理的数据库, PostgreSQL就被认为比MySQL更加强大,虽然PostgreSQL最终也将通过OpenStack管理,但何时将通过OpenStack来管理的时间还不确定。

Tesora的计划是让MongoDB首先可通过Trove进行管理,允许这两个数据库的实例在OpenStack内并排运行。与MySQL一样,MongoDB并不是唯一的NoSQL解决方案;CouchDB、Riak和Couchbase都是可能的选项。但从MongoDB开始肯定不会出错,与竞争对手相比,MongoDB具有更广泛的部署率,更不用提对MongoDB专业知识不断增长的需求。

对于OpenStack(及其供应商)的竞争主要在于,通过Rackspace的NoSQL即服务。尽管OpenStack的供应商已经做了很多工作让OpenStack可以更容易部署,但人们仍然认为OpenStack没有得到相应的部署,同时也给部署它的人带来额外的负担。如果企业可以得到足够的相同功能、细粒度,并能从第三方服务提供商获得支持,那么OpenStack的部署将会更加广泛。

另一个间接竞争来源,至少从托管NoSQL的交付来看,可能来自于IBM。该公司已经转移其自己的云计算[注]到OpenStack。最近IBM对Cloudant公司的收购让该公司能够以CouchDB的形式提供NoSQL即服务,CouchDB是另一个主要NoSQL数据库品牌。这不太可能以任何方式挖走已经承诺使用MongoDB的用户,但这表明另一种解决方案选项的存在。

对于那些想要寻找更多实践信息的用户,Tesora将在即将举行的OpenStack峰会上展示MySQL和MongoDB如何可以通过Trove部署和管理。

我们一直都在努力坚持原创.......请不要一声不吭,就悄悄拿走。

我原创,你原创,我们的内容世界才会更加精彩!

【所有原创内容版权均属TechTarget,欢迎大家转发分享。但未经授权,严禁任何媒体(平面媒体、网络媒体、自媒体等)以及微信公众号复制、转载、摘编或以其他方式进行使用。】

微信公众号

TechTarget微信公众号二维码

TechTarget

官方微博

TechTarget中国官方微博二维码

TechTarget中国

相关推荐